2026 Tax Breakdown for $50,118,000 in Arizona
| Tax | Rate | Annual Amount |
|---|---|---|
| Gross Salary | — | $50,118,000 |
| Federal Income TaxAfter $16,100 std. deduction → $50,101,900 taxable | 36.9% | −$18,493,660 |
| Social Security (6.2% · capped at $184,500) | 6.20% | −$11,439 |
| Medicare (1.45%) | 1.45% | −$726,711 |
| Additional Medicare (0.9% over $200K) | 0.90% | −$449,262 |
| Arizona State Income TaxTop rate: 2.5% · $14,600 state deduction | 2.5% | −$1,252,585 |
| Total Tax | 41.8% | −$20,933,657 |
| Take-Home Pay | 58.2% | $29,184,343 |
Calculations based on 2026 IRS brackets and official state tax tables. Single, standard deduction applied. State tax is estimated — actual amounts vary by credits and deductions.

2026 Federal Tax Brackets (Single)
| Bracket | Taxable Income Range | Rate |
|---|---|---|
| $0 – $12,399 | 10% | |
| $12,400 – $50,399 | 12% | |
| $50,400 – $105,699 | 22% | |
| $105,700 – $201,774 | 24% | |
| $201,775 – $256,224 | 32% | |
| $256,225 – $640,599 | 35% | |
| ← Your top bracket | Over $640,600 | 37% |
After $16,100 standard deduction, your federal taxable income is $50,101,900.
